>How well isolated are the CPU dependencies in AT&T System V Release 4?
>Do almost all of the modules change between a 68030 version and a 486
>version or do only a few modules change?

The 68k and 386 base ports are separate source trees.  There are some
things that were added for the 386 kernel only (for instance some
cruft dealing with stream head processing).

You have some work ahead of you.
